On 2012-11-09 12:05, Daniel Stonier wrote:Afaik the rosdistro file tells the build job which version to check out, it needs to exactly match the tagged one you released:

I'm trying catkinization & bloom for the first time on a very simple msg/srv package (zeroconf_comms) which is having trouble building the source debian on jenkins.
It is not looking for the correct tag, in particular, it's not looking for the increment number that is postfixed to the version number for the package.
https://github.com/ros/rosdistro/blob/master/releases/groovy.yaml
It appears to be 0.1.7 where it should be 0.1.7-0. The debian-increment number now always gets added, and is 0 by default.
I usually directly edit the file at github to adjust the version numbers, that will create a patch and pull request automatically - neat!
